Back story: 12/14 bought an 02 Xterra 3.3L with 126K that had a small RMS leak. Immediately changed oil to Maxlife 5W-30, a Wix 57356, and added 1/2 bottle of ATP AT-205 that everyone raves about. Reason for 1/2 bottle is this engine has a 3.5 qt. sump. At 3K I changed oil with ML 5W-30 again and added the other 1/2 bottle of AT-205 but I left the Wix on for another 3K. Around 2K into this OCI I started noticing some start-up clatter. It wasn't much so I left the filter on and went to 3100 (the clatter got a little louder) and filled with Pennzoil HM 5W-30 and a NAPA Gold 7356 that looks identical to the Wix. Cold start clatter gone. I mentioned this a while ago and someone wondered if the ADB valve went bad. I've never cut a filter before and was really curious so figuring what the heck I drained all the oil out and ground through the crimp with a flap disc and it popped right apart. Here are the photos and the interesting thing is the black rubber seal that's inside the one part is all swelled and deformed. I don't know how this all works but it was definitely off center, did this allow drain-back? First time using the AT-205 and first time with a 2X FCI. Some oil still shows up on the crossmember but doesn't drip now. My first cut/post, did I miss anything? Thoughts?
